noun
- plural of cattleman; men who tend, herd, or raise cattle
Usage: chiefly North American; often used in historical or ranching contexts
Examples
- The cattlemen drove their herds across the open range.
- Experienced cattlemen know how to manage large herds in difficult terrain.
- In the Old West, cattlemen were essential to the ranching industry.
- The cattlemen gathered at the auction to buy and sell livestock.
- Modern cattlemen use trucks and helicopters instead of horses.
- Local cattlemen worked together to protect their herds from predators.
